10th House in Capricorn vs. Midheaven (MC) in Capricorn

In astrology, the 10th house and the Midheaven (MC) both point toward your public life, career direction, and reputation — but they describe it in slightly different ways.  In Whole Sign astrology, the 10th house encompasses the entire sign that rules it, while the MC can float through the 9th, 10th, or 11th houses, adding extra dimension to how your calling becomes visible.

When both the 10th house and MC are in Capricorn, your reputation is unmistakably Saturnian: disciplined, dependable, and deeply respected. You’re seen as someone who earns success through effort, wisdom, and consistency — a person whose word and work carry weight.

If your MC falls in a different sign, it adds another layer to your public image. For example:

  • Capricorn 10th house + Sagittarius MC → A visionary builder who combines structure with optimism, teaching, or travel.
  • Capricorn 10th house + Aquarius MC → A reformer who modernizes traditions through innovation and strategic systems.
  • Capricorn 10th house + Pisces MC → A compassionate leader who brings emotional intelligence and empathy to positions of authority.

In essence, the 10th house shows what you’re here to build, while the Midheaven shows how the world sees the structure you’ve built.  Capricorn in either place reminds you that greatness isn’t accidental — it’s crafted through intention, maturity, and the willingness to climb one step higher than you did yesterday.

The Role of Saturn as Ruler of the 10th House in Capricorn

Because Saturn rules Capricorn, its placement in your chart becomes the cornerstone for understanding how your 10th house in Capricorn unfolds. Saturn symbolizes structure, endurance, and self-mastery — the slow, deliberate climb toward success that’s built on integrity rather than impulse.

When Capricorn leads your 10th house, Saturn’s influence is strong and direct. It reveals where you’re called to build, how you handle responsibility, and what kind of legacy you’re constructing over time. Saturn’s lessons can feel demanding, but they’re never without purpose. Every challenge it brings is meant to refine your discipline and strengthen your foundations.

In traditional astrology, Saturn is the planet of time, maturity, and wisdom earned through experience. It teaches that lasting success isn’t about perfection — it’s about persistence. The placement of Saturn by sign, house, and aspect shows the nature of your ambition and how your efforts evolve into mastery.

When Saturn (Ruler of the 10th) Is in Different Signs

This reveals the tone and style of your Capricorn 10th house expression — how you approach your goals and define achievement:

  • Aries: Builds through bold action and independence; learns to temper drive with patience.
  • Taurus: Creates through stability and practicality; success grows slowly but endures.
  • Gemini: Communicates structure through ideas, writing, or teaching; intellect becomes influence.
  • Cancer: Leads through care and protection; builds systems that nurture and sustain others.
  • Leo: Earns respect through creativity and confident leadership; authority expressed with warmth.
  • Virgo: Perfects and organizes; succeeds by improving systems and mastering detail.
  • Libra: Constructs harmony through partnership and diplomacy; excels in law, design, or mediation.
  • Scorpio: Transforms through depth and resilience; success tied to emotional or psychological insight.
  • Sagittarius: Expands through philosophy, faith, or education; wisdom becomes one’s legacy.
  • Capricorn: Double emphasis — true mastery, authority, and leadership through perseverance.
  • Aquarius: Innovates within structure; reforms systems with vision and strategic foresight.
  • Pisces: Builds compassion into institutions; leads quietly through empathy and understanding.

When Saturn (Ruler of the 10th) Is in Different Houses

This shows where your professional growth and legacy-building efforts are most visible:

  • 1st House: Leadership and self-discipline define your public identity; success through authenticity.
  • 2nd House: Builds wealth and self-worth over time; values consistency and resource management.
  • 3rd House: Career success through communication, education, or strategic networking.
  • 4th House: Creates stability through family, real estate, or honoring ancestral roots.
  • 5th House: Builds a legacy through creativity, teaching, or nurturing others’ potential.
  • 6th House: Excels through service, problem-solving, and consistent effort in practical work.
  • 7th House: Partnership and collaboration are keys to achievement and public recognition.
  • 8th House: Works through transformation, shared resources, or depth psychology; power earned wisely.
  • 9th House: Builds influence through higher education, law, or cross-cultural impact.
  • 10th House: Double emphasis — public authority and mastery; your career is your calling.
  • 11th House: Success through collective goals, networks, and long-term vision.
  • 12th House: Creates quietly behind the scenes; builds through healing, reflection, or spiritual purpose.
